Truthfully, this is a rough estimate and it usually tells us how long it will take to recharge the battery to about 80% of its capacity. If the battery is fully discharged then the first approximation for the charge time is (50 Amps*Hours) divided by (10 Amps) = 5 Hours. The dash that normally appears between Amp and Hours has been replaced by the multiplication sign (*) to emphasize the behavior of these 2 items in a mathematical equation. These are fairly typical sizes for an automotive engine start type battery and an automotive battery charger. Let’s say I have a 50 Amp-Hour battery and a 10 Amp charger. (Battery Capacity) / (Charger Current) = Hours I knew Battery Tender had an equation on their website which allows you to calculate the recharge time: So having to find specific information on my battery was not needed.
